On Tue, 2010-06-29 at 15:35 +0100, Jan Beulich wrote:
>
> The (only) additional overhead this introduces for native execution is
> the writing of the owning CPU in the lock acquire paths.

Uhm, and growing the size of spinlock_t to 6 (or 8 bytes when aligned)
bytes when NR_CPUS>256.
